You need to pull the gaiters back and look at the ball joint. If it's round body then you can't get replacements except off another rack (easier to replace whole rack unless yours is a super s), if it's square and has a locking tab then you can replace just tie rod. Can be done without taking rack off car too.
There is also a sealed type rack that cannot have the joints replaced at all, but I never seen one...

Buy yourself a socket set, a jack and some axle stands, it takes about an hour to get rack out, hour to get new one in. Half the time if you're just replacing tie rods. Same cost as a garage, but you have a car AND a socket set, jack and axle stands at the end of it.
